Lloyd M. Bucher papers, 1968-2000

Collection context

Summary

Creators:
Bucher, Lloyd M., 1927-2004
Abstract:
Correspondence, clippings, reports, court inquiry proceedings, photographs, plaques, and memorabilia, relating to the capture of the intelligence ship Pueblo by North Korea in 1968 and the imprisonment and subsequent release of its crew. Includes drafts and galleys of memoirs, entitled Bucher: My Story (Garden City, N.Y., 1970).
Extent:
73 manuscript boxes, 3 oversize boxes (31.2 Linear Feet)
